Cenntura was having fun playing poker she needed the next two cards out to be heart so she could make a flesh five cards of the same suit there are 10 cards left on the deck and three our hearts what is the probability that two cards doubt to Seterra without replacement will both be hearts answer choices are in percentage for format rounded to the nearest whole number

Answers

Answer:

7% probability that the next 2 cards are hearts.

Step-by-step explanation:

Cards are chosen without replacement, which means that the hypergeometric distribution is used to solve this question.

Hypergeometric distribution:

The probability of x successes is given by the following formula:

[tex]P(X = x) = h(x,N,n,k) = \frac{C_{k,x}*C_{N-k,n-x}}{C_{N,n}}[/tex]

In which:

x is the number of successes.

N is the size of the population.

n is the size of the sample.

k is the total number of desired outcomes.

Combinations formula:

[tex]C_{n,x}[/tex] is the number of different combinations of x objects from a set of n elements, given by the following formula.

[tex]C_{n,x} = \frac{n!}{x!(n-x)!}[/tex]

In this question:

10 cards, which means that [tex]N = 10[/tex]

3 are hearts, which means that [tex]k = 3[/tex]

Probability that the next 2 cards are hearts:

This is P(X = 2) when n = 2. So

[tex]P(X = x) = h(x,N,n,k) = \frac{C_{k,x}*C_{N-k,n-x}}{C_{N,n}}[/tex]

[tex]P(X = 2) = h(2,10,2,3) = \frac{C_{3,2}*C_{7,0}}{C_{10,2}} = 0.0667[/tex]

0.0667*100% = 6.67%

Rounded to the nearest whole number, 7% probability that the next 2 cards are hearts.

Which equation could represent each grapes polynomial function?

Answers

9514 1404 393

Answer:

top graph: y = x(x +3)(x -2)bottom graph: y = x⁴ -5x² +4

Step-by-step explanation:

Each x-intercept at x=a corresponds to a polynomial factor of (x -a).

__

The top graph has x-intercepts of -3, 0, +2, so the factors of this cubic are ...

  y = (x +3)(x -0)(x -2)

  y = x(x +3)(x -2) . . . . . . . matches upper right tile

__

The bottom graph has x-intercepts of -2, -1, 1, 2, so the factors of this quartic are ...

  y = (x +2)(x +1)(x -1)(x -2) = (x² -4)(x² -1)

  y = x⁴ -5x² +4 . . . . . . . matches lower left tile

Tim Hortons is hiring and offers $200 every week plus $5 per hour. McDonalds offers $300 every week plus $2 per hour. State the conditions under which Tim Hortons is the better employer

Answers

Answer:

Assuming you want better payment each week, any number of hours above 33.333 or 33 hours and 20 minutes per week

Step-by-step explanation:

There are several ways we could do this.  We could say we want to have Tim Hortons be the better employer on the first week, or after so many weeks by adjusting the hours.  I am going to assume we are saying we want it to be a better employer on the first week, so the profit will be the amount made every week plus the money made per hour times the number of hours.

Let's say number of hours is H

So Tim Hortons winds up as 200 + 5H for one week and  Mcdonalds will be 300 + 2H.

If you set the two expressions equal to each other you will find where they intersect, which means at that number of hours they will give the same amount of money while any amount before one of the companies will give more and after that many hours the other will.  Let's go ahead and solve.

200 + 5H = 300 + 2H

3H = 100

H = 100/3

So H is about 33.333.  let's check.

200 + 5(33.333) = 366.665 which rounds to 366.67 dollars

300 + 2(33.333) = 366.666 which also rounds to 366.67 dollars

So at 33.333 hours both give 366.67 dollars.  Let's look at a value below it, say 32.

200 + 5(32) = 360

300 + 2(32) = 364

So you can see here Tim Hortons  pays less.  Now we will try 34 as a value above 33.333

200 + 5(32) = 370

300 + 2(32) = 368

Here Mcdonalds pays less.  This was to show that values below 33.333 make Tim Hortonspay less and values above 33.333 make Mcdonalds pay less.  In other words any value above 33.333 hours will have Tim Hortons be the better employer.  And this is per week

I want to repeat, you can expand this to be multiple weeks and see which of the two becomes better in that epriod of time.  This was, I think, the simplest way to answer though.  

So the conditions where Tim Horton pays more isif you work more than 33.333 hours per week.  This will make them pay more every single week.

Find a, b, c, and d such that the cubic function f(x) = ax3 + bx? + cx + d satisfies the given conditions.
Relative maximum: (2,9)
Relative minimum: (4,3)
Inflection point: (3,6)
a =
b =
C=
d =

Answers

Answer:

[tex]\displaystyle f(x)=\frac{3}{2}x^3-\frac{27}{2}x^2+36x-21[/tex]

Where:

[tex]\displaystyle a=\frac{3}{2}, \, b=-\frac{27}{2}, \, c=36, \text{and } d=-21[/tex]

Step-by-step explanation:

We are given a cubic function:

[tex]f(x)=ax^3+bx^2+cx+d[/tex]

And we want to find a, b, c and d such that the  function has a relative maximum at (2, 9); a relative mininum at (4, 3); and an inflection point at (3, 6).

Since the function has a relative maximum at (2, 9), this means that:

[tex]f(2)=9=a(2)^3+b(2)^2+c(2)+d[/tex]

Simplify:

[tex]8a+4b+2c+d=9[/tex]

Likewise, since it has a relative minimum at (4, 3):

[tex]f(4)=3=a(4)^3+b(4)^2+c(4)+d[/tex]

Simplify:

[tex]64a+16b+4c+d=3[/tex]

We can subtract the first equation from the second. So:

[tex](64a+16b+4c+d)-(8a+4b+2c+d)=(3)-(9)[/tex]

Simplify:

[tex]56a+12b+2c=-6[/tex]

Divide both sides by two. Hence:

[tex]28a+6b+c=-3[/tex]

Relative minima occurs only at the critical points of a function. That is, it occurs whenever the first derivative equals zero.

Find the first derivative. We can treat a, b, c and d as constant. Hence:

[tex]f'(x)=3ax^2+2bx+c[/tex]

Since it has a minima at (2, 9), it means that:

[tex]f'(2)=3a(2)^2+2b(2)+c=0[/tex]

Thus:

[tex]12a+4b+c=0[/tex]

(We will only need one of the two points to complete the problem.)

Inflection points occurs whenever the second derivative of a function equals zero. Find the second derivative:

[tex]f''(x)=6ax+2b[/tex]

Since there is a inflection point at (3, 6):

[tex]18a+2b=0\Rightarrow 9a+b=0[/tex]

Solve for b:

[tex]b=-9a[/tex]

Substitute this into the above equation:

[tex]12a+4(-9a)+c=0[/tex]

Solve for c:

[tex]c=24a[/tex]

Substitute b and c into the previously acquired equation:

[tex]28a+6(-9a)+(24a)=-3[/tex]

Solve for a:

[tex]\displaystyle -2a=-3\Rightarrow a=\frac{3}{2}[/tex]

Solve for b and c:

[tex]\displaystyle b=-9\left(\frac{3}{2}\right)=-\frac{27}{2}\text{ and } c=24\left(\frac{3}{2}\right)=36[/tex]

Using either the very first or second equation, solve for d:

[tex]\displaystyle 8\left(\frac{3}{2}\right)+4\left(-\frac{27}{2}\right)+2(36)+d=9[/tex]

Hence:

[tex]d=-21[/tex]

Hence, our function is:

[tex]\displaystyle f(x)=\frac{3}{2}x^3-\frac{27}{2}x^2+36x-21[/tex]
